Gladwin County, MI Hispanic or Latino Population By Race in 2021

Updated on August 4, 2024.

Based on the US Census Vintage data estimates, in 2021, there were 538 people in Gladwin County, MI who identified as Hispanic or Latino. Among this group, 90.52% (487) identified their race as White, 5.20% (28) identified their race as American Indian and Alaska Native, and 2.23% (12) identified their race as Two Or More Races .
